A Pilot Study Exploring Caregivers' Experiences Related to the Use of a Smart Toothbrush by Children with Autism Spectrum Disorder.
Children 2024 April 12
BACKGROUND: Research on caregivers for children with intellectual disabilities, particularly those with autism spectrum disorder (ASD), has highlighted several obstacles to achieving better oral health. These include challenges with tolerating oral care, sensory processing differences, uncooperative behaviors, and communication impairments. There is limited understanding of what caregivers would consider "successful assistance" in improving oral health for these children.
OBJECTIVES: This pilot study aimed to examine caregivers' and user's experiences with a Kids Smart Electric Toothbrush used by children with ASD.
METHODS: It involved open-ended interviews and questionnaires with caregivers prior to utilization of the toothbrush and after 4 weeks of product use by the child.
RESULTS: Seventeen children with ASD, aged 5-12, participated. A total of 58.8% of caregivers said their child brushed more often, and all reported brushing at least twice a day by week 4. Caregivers reported that children became more independent while brushing their teeth and achieved better quality brushing. Caregivers' frustration with the brushing process, satisfaction with the device, and need to assist the child with brushing were improved. Caregivers did encounter some technical difficulties with the app.
CONCLUSION: This study will assist in exploring "smart" toothbrush technologies for oral hygiene in children with ASD.
